Property

PropertyBullionTarget
Alpha acid5.3–12.5%8.5–13.5%
Beta acid4.5–6.5%4.3–5.7%
Co-humulone47–50%35–40%
Total oil1–2 mL1–1.4 mL
Myrcene40–55%45–55%
Humulene15–25%17–23%
Caryophyllene9–14%8–10%
Farnesene0–1%0–1%
OriginUnited StatesUnited Kingdom
PurposeDual purposeBittering
